Construction - November 2004

Builders accelerated their growth rate

Seasonally adjusted construction output at constant prices was 1.4% up month-on-month .

Year-on-year , total construction output at constant prices increased by 9.9% or 6.9% if adjusted for the number of working days (there were 2 more working days in November 2004) .

The growth accelerated in new construction in building and civil engineering. The volume of construction work on repairs and maintenance of constructions decreased mildly.

The number of employees in construction enterprises with 20+ employed people rose by 4.7%. The average monthly wage of employees reached CZK 21 482 and increased year-on-year by 7.6%, while the real wage increased by 4.6%. Average hourly wage amounted to CZK 138 and decreased by 0.3%. Labour productivity per employee increased by 4.9 % and labour productivity per hour worked decreased by 2.8 %. Unit wage costs were 2.6 % up. The wages and employment indicators were also affected by the higher number of working days in November 2004.

The planning and building control authorities granted 13 501 building permits in November (of which 6 893 for new construction and 6 608 for renewals and enhancements). The approximate value of the constructions permitted in November was CZK 28.9 billion (of which new constructions accounted for CZK 21.9 billion and renewals and enhancements for CZK 7.0 billion).

The planning and building control authorities permitted 3 398 dwellings to be constructed – a decrease of 434 dwellings year-on-year. New construction should provide 2 746 dwellings (a decrease of 267 dwellings). The number of new dwellings obtained by renewals and enhancements will reach 652 (by 167 less). The figures on the new dwellings are influenced by the high reference basis of November 2003. The approximate value of the newly permitted dwellings in multi-dwelling buildings reached CZK 7.5 billion. The approximate value per dwelling was CZK 2.5 million for new construction or CZK 1.0 million for renewals and enhancements.
